Context
-----------
The financial crisis of 2008 and 2009, the subprime crisis and the collapse of Lehman Brothers prompted banks to freeze inter banking credit, causing a liquidity crisis. Since liquidity has become an indicator closely watched by banks and regulators.

The Liquidity project is a major project within the Société Générale group which aims to provide reports on the liquidity of the bank to regulation bodies such as Prudential Control Authority (formerly Commission Bancaire) in France and the Financial Services Authority (FSA) in England. It also allows managing and effectively taking into account the liquidity risk to ensure effective internal control on liquidity management and implementation of the new Basel III requirements (LCR, NSFR).

The LIQOR application aims to retrieve data from many applications, to enrich, to perform calculations and then generate reporting. It is a full Microsoft .Net application that consists of a Windows service, a custom workflow management engine, custom calculation modules, a SSIS 2008 packages and an ASP.Net web application.
